Smoother Agenda Drawer, Reliable Onboarding Tours, and Refreshed Japanese Copy

The best product improvements are the ones users never have to think about—because what was janky is now smooth. This release focused on three areas that generate quiet friction.

Guided tours are now bundled with the application rather than loaded from an external source. Tours that previously failed to appear in certain network environments or browser configurations now launch consistently for all users, including parents encountering the scheduling flow for the first time.

The agenda drawer—the panel parents use to review and modify their conference schedule—now behaves more predictably when opened on mobile devices, with scroll behavior that doesn't compete with the page behind it.

Finally, the Japanese locale received a content refresh. Several translated strings that had drifted from how the interface actually works were updated to reflect current functionality, making the experience feel locally written rather than machine-translated.
